Requirements:
-xNVSE
-kNVSE
-JIP LN NVSE
-ISControl Enabler

The original mod is not required. All credit goes to Hitman47101 for his work on the original mod. This mod was modified and reuploaded under the permission rules on the original page, which states that I'm allowed to modify and reupload the mod and its assets as long as credit is given.

This mod converts Iron Sights Recoil Animations by Hitman47101 to work via kNVSE/ISControl Enabler instead of the old replacement method. This means you shouldn't have to make patches for your weapon mesh mods anymore (I.E. WMX, which is what this mod was tested with). Most vanilla weapons are supported (see known issues), as well as DLC weapons. I've also added support for the Weathered 10mm Pistol that WMX gives you since it needs to swap it out.

Known issues:
-The .44 magnum animations don't work if you use WMX. Sincerely don't know why, as the Mysterious Magnum works. Both seem to work if you use WMIM, from what I've been told.
-The Alien Blaster's animations work, but are very broken somehow. It'll be off-center when aiming, but center itself when firing.
-For whatever reason, the mod will not work the first time when a new game is started, and possibly not the first load after installing. Saving and restarting the game seems to fix it.
